
Horse Day
Mohamed Bourouissa
For the Horse Day series, in which he designs, stages, and documents an equestrian event, Bourouissa focuses on the efforts of a North Philadelphia community to revitalize the neighborhood.
Inspired by American photographer Martha Camarillo's photographs of the horsemen of Strawberry Mansion-an impoverished Philadelphia neighborhood-Bourouissa traveled there to see for himself the urban stables run by these men. For eight months he observed, sketched and photographed them. With a strong collaborative sensibility, Bourouissa integrated himself into the community, which led him to suggest to the men that they organize a contest, “Horse Day,” in which artists from other neighborhoods would be invited to create costumes for the horses. The video documents the event and its preparations, and acts as an examination of how society is structured and social processes are activated.
